But it's clearly invested a lot of time and money in creating Nook Video from scratch as it gets set to unveil new hardware. A lot of folks thought it would enlist a third-party service such as Vudu. That Barnes & Noble would build its video offering in house is a bit of a surprise. this "holiday season" with content from major studios, including HBO, Sony, Starz, and Warner Bros, and Disney. Well, it took a little longer than expected, but today the company has announced that it's launching Nook Video this fall in the U.S. Last year when it launched its Nook Tablet, Barnes & Noble strongly hinted that it was looking to add a video service to the device that would allow users to buy and rent movies and television shows. B&N has launched a homegrown video service.
